MladenKarachanov

Untitled

May 11th, 2022
108
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 3.70 KB | None | 0 0
  1. 6. Пребоядисване
  2. Румен иска да пребоядиса хола и за целта е наел майстори. Напишете програма, която изчислява разходите за ремонта, предвид следните цени:
  3. • Предпазен найлон - 1.50 лв. за кв. метър
  4. • Боя - 14.50 лв. за литър
  5. • Разредител за боя - 5.00 лв. за литър
  6. За всеки случай, към необходимите материали, Румен иска да добави още 10% от количеството боя и 2 кв.м. найлон, разбира се и 0.40 лв. за торбички. Сумата, която се заплаща на майсторите за 1 час работа, е равна на 30% от сбора на всички разходи за материали.
  7. Вход
  8. Входът се чете от конзолата и съдържа точно 4 реда:
  9. 1. Необходимо количество найлон (в кв.м.) - цяло число в интервала [1... 100]
  10. 2. Необходимо количество боя (в литри) - цяло число в интервала [1…100]
  11. 3. Количество разредител (в литри) - цяло число в интервала [1…30]
  12. 4. Часовете, за които майсторите ще свършат работата - цяло число в интервала [1…9]
  13. Изход
  14. Да се отпечата на конзолата един ред:
  15. • "{сумата на всички разходи}"
  16. Примерен вход и изход
  17. Вход Изход Обяснения
  18. 10
  19. 11
  20. 4
  21. 8 727.09 Сума за найлон: (10 + 2) * 1.50 = 18 лв.
  22. Сума за боя: (11 + 10%) * 14.50 = 175.45 лв.
  23. Сума за разредител: 4 * 5.00 = 20.00 лв.
  24. Сума за торбички: 0.40 лв.
  25. Обща сума за материали: 18 + 175.45 + 20.00 + 0.40 = 213.85 лв.
  26. Сума за майстори: (213.85 * 30%) * 8 = 513.24 лв.
  27. Крайна сума: 213.85 + 513.24 = 727.09 лв.
  28. 5
  29. 10
  30. 10
  31. 1 286.52 Сума за найлон: (5 + 2) * 1.50 = 10.50 лв.
  32. Сума за боя: (10 + 10%) * 14.50 = 159.50 лв.
  33. Сума за разредител: 10 * 5.00 = 50.00 лв.
  34. Сума за торбички: 0.40 лв.
  35. Обща сума за материали: 10.50 + 159.50 + 50.00 + 0.40 = 220.40 лв.
  36. Сума за майстори: (220.40 * 30%) * 1 = 66.12 лв.
  37. Крайна сума: 220.40 + 66.12 = 286.52 лв.
  38.  
  39.  
  40.  
  41.  
  42. package firstStepsInCoding;
  43.  
  44. import java.util.Scanner;
  45.  
  46. public class Repainting {
  47. public static void main(String[] args) {
  48. Scanner scanner= new Scanner(System.in);
  49. int nylon=Integer.parseInt(scanner.nextLine());
  50. int paint=Integer.parseInt(scanner.nextLine());
  51. int thinner=Integer.parseInt(scanner.nextLine());
  52. int hours=Integer.parseInt(scanner.nextLine());
  53. double priceNylon=1.50;
  54. double pricePaint=14.50;
  55. double priceThinner=5.00;
  56.  
  57. double totalNylon=(nylon+2)*priceNylon;
  58. int totalPaint=paint*10/100;
  59. double result=(paint+totalPaint)*pricePaint;
  60.  
  61. System.out.println(result);
  62.  
  63. }
  64. }
  65.  
  66.  
  67.  
  68. C:\Users\LENOVO\.jdks\openjdk-15.0.2\bin\java.exe "-javaagent:C:\Users\LENOVO\AppData\Local\JetBrains\IntelliJ IDEA Community Edition 2020.3.2\lib\idea_rt.jar=60596:C:\Users\LENOVO\AppData\Local\JetBrains\IntelliJ IDEA Community Edition 2020.3.2\bin" -Dfile.encoding=UTF-8 -classpath C:\Users\LENOVO\IdeaProjects\java\out\production\java firstStepsInCoding.Repainting
  69. 10
  70. 11
  71. 4
  72. 8
  73. 174.0
  74.  
  75. Process finished with exit code 0
  76.  
Add Comment
Please, Sign In to add comment